    The Denver Bronco's welcomed the unbeaten Ravens to mile high in what proved to be an interesting game.
    Q1
    Bronco's kickoff with a crazy wind at their back,something like 18 and the wind actually did have an effect in the game as whoever had it was driving the ball a mile off punts.Ravens put a few plays together but are forced to punt,which didn't go all that far due to the wind leaving the broncos with good field position.A few plays later the Broncos were in with a pass play to D.Thomas who shrugged off the tackle for a 20 yard TD(From memory I think the Ravens pretty much shutdown Thomas after this). 7-0
    Ravens start from their own 20 and put together a very good mixed with nice passes to Zach Miller and the read option between Rice and Kapernick was working a treat ending with a nice TD pass to Gettis 7-7
    Ravens force a quick 3 and out,Broncos punt from their own 13,its goes a long way,looks like its gonna land on the Ravens 25,ravens reciever goes towards the ball,then decides not to,then does,doesn't......ball rolls and lands on the Ravens 2 where a Bronco players touchs it.
    Q2
    Ravens start on their own 2,first throw is iffy,goes up in air between 3 Broncos players,they all go up for it,end up hitting against each other in the air...pass is incomplete.Next pass goes for a short to Zach Miller wo's absolutely nailed,injury timeout,very next play he's back in,Indestructable!
    Broncos force the punt on the next play.
    The ball then swaps back and forth between the teams alot here due mostly to sacks on the Ravens from Kruger,Ngata and J.Smith while the Broncos manage a sack from Von Miller.
    Finally the Broncos put together a few runs to make it out to their 42,then a pass from Manning to 4th choice reciever Caldwell finds him in space with about 50 yards out and a safety to beat.A so a game of cat and mouse begins,Caldwell on the wing is running,waiting for the safety who's got the angle on him to come across in order to time a juke or spin move inside him.Caldwell makes it to the 35,the safety hasn't fully commited yet,Caldwell think he has a chance of making it now and throws on the afterburners,safety comes across.....he's not gonna make it,Caldwell sprints away,TD 14-7
    With a minute left on the clock the Ravens make a few plays but are forced to punt after another sack from Von Miller.
    Broncos end the quarter with a 57 yard FG attempt against the wind.....ya its doesn't even come close.14-7 halftime score in a tight game
    3Q
    Broncos first drive of the half couldn't have gone any worse,a sack on Manning from Brackett was then followed by an INT by Munnerlyn.
    Broncos D hold firm and Ravens take a FG. 14-10
    Broncos put together a good drive to get 1st and goal.1st play,Manning scans the redzone,every1 is covered so he tucks the ball under his arm and breaks off on a run.Touchdown Peyton Manning 21-10
    Ravens move the ball up to well inside the Broncos half but then a screen pass goes wrong as the Broncos D comes too fast causing Kap to fumble which DT F.Robbins falls on it(for a big man he's had 2 or 3 fumble recoveries this season and a sack or 2,you wouldn't think it looking at him).
    Q4
    Abit into the half the Broncos manage to run in a 25 yard TD with Moreno after some good blocking 28-10
    Ravens drive up to the Broncos with some good runs from Rice and Kapernick doing really well on the read option but just as things were begining to go right for Kap he throws an INT pass.
    With 3 mins left on the clocks Broncos start running it and Ravens start using their timeouts.They hold Broncos to 3rd and 7,make or break time for the Ravens,Broncos come out in pass play,everyone is covered Manning tucks the ball and goes for the 7...and makes it.
    Broncos run down the clock after than and add another TD by pure fluke.
    Ravens try to move the ball down down the field but time is ultimately against them.
    Full time score Broncos 35 Ravens 10
